Granholm picked for vice chairwoman spot

December 2, 2004

Michigan's first female governor will join fellow Democratic governors in assisting her political party's cause.

Gov. Jennifer Granholm is set to become vice chairwoman of the national Democratic Governors' Association when she attends the group's biannual meeting today.

The governors will convene in Washington, D.C., to elect new leadership and set their agenda for 2005.

As vice chairwoman, Granholm will be involved with lobbying, setting policy and assisting in campaign activities for Democratic governors in the national spotlight.
